What We Evaluate
A neuropsychological evaluation is much more than just a diagnosis; it is a deep dive into cognitive strengths and areas for growth. We specialize in testing for:
- Attention-Deficit/Hyperactive Disorder (ADHD): Moving beyond simple checklists to understand how executive functions (planning, focus, and impulse control) impact daily life.
-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D): Providing neuro-affirming evaluations to understand social communication patterns and sensory profiles.
- Learning Disabilities: Comprehensive testing for Dyslexia (reading), Dysgraphia (writing), and Dyscalculia (math) to secure necessary school accommodations (IEPs/504 Plans).
- Intellectual & Developmental Disabilities: Assessing cognitive potential and adaptive skills to ensure proper support and resources.
- Executive Functioning & Memory: Identifying why a person may struggle with organization, "brain fog," or following multi-step directions.
Our Process: What to Expect
We have designed our evaluation process to be clear, supportive, and focused on actionable results.
- Initial Consultation: A brief conversation to discuss your concerns, review history, and ensure this is the right next step for you or your child.
- The Testing Discovery: Conducted in a comfortable, low-stress environment. We use a variety of interactive tasks, puzzles, and assessments tailored to the individual’s age and needs.
- Comprehensive Analysis: We don’t just look at scores. We integrate history, observations, and data to create a holistic picture of the individual.
- The Feedback Session: We meet with you to review the findings in "plain English." You will receive a detailed report including a formal diagnosis (if applicable) and, most importantly, a personalized plan for school, work, and home.
